Can I Sell Books Through BooksCloud if My Store Is on WooCommerce or BigCommerce Instead of Shopify?

This is one of the most common questions from merchants who discover BooksCloud but are already running their store on a different platform. The direct answer: no. BooksCloud is a Shopify-exclusive application. It does not currently integrate with WooCommerce, BigCommerce, Wix, Squarespace, or any other e-commerce platform.

Why BooksCloud Is Shopify-Only

BooksCloud is built and distributed through the Shopify App Store, operated by splitShops, Inc. The entire architecture of the product - catalog sync, order routing, fulfillment communication, tracking updates - is built specifically around Shopify's API and infrastructure. The connection between your store and BooksCloud's fulfillment backend is native to Shopify's ecosystem.

This is not an unusual situation. Many of the most capable dropshipping apps in the book and general merchandise space are Shopify-native. The Shopify App Store gives developers a consistent, well-documented platform to build on, and it gives merchants a trusted, vetted source for installing third-party integrations. The trade-off is that those integrations only work inside that ecosystem.

WooCommerce and BigCommerce both have their own strengths, but BooksCloud has not built integrations for either platform, and there is no workaround or unofficial connector that would allow the app to function outside of Shopify.

What If You Already Have a WooCommerce or BigCommerce Store?

If you have an existing store on another platform and want to use BooksCloud, you have two main paths:

Option 1 - Add a Shopify store alongside your existing store. Shopify Basic is approximately $39/month. You could run a separate Shopify storefront specifically for book sales while keeping your existing store for other product categories. This is a more complex operation but some merchants find it worth it depending on their catalog mix.

Option 2 - Migrate to Shopify. If books are going to be a significant part of your business and you are still in early stages with your current platform, migrating to Shopify may be the cleaner long-term move. BooksCloud's product catalog sync, Bulk Sync automation, and order flow are deeply integrated with Shopify in ways that make it the natural home for this kind of book dropshipping operation.
